The Science Behind Micro-Recovery
The concept is rooted in the ultradian rhythm—the body's natural 90-120 minute cycles of high and low energy. During the high phase, you can focus intensely. After that, a dip occurs, signaling the need for rest. Micro-recovery aligns with these dips, allowing your parasympathetic nervous system to activate and reduce stress. For example, a 60-second deep breathing exercise can lower heart rate and improve oxygen flow to the brain. This isn't just theory; many practitioners in high-stakes fields, like air traffic control and emergency medicine, use micro-recovery to maintain vigilance. They take short moments to stretch, close their eyes, or take a few slow breaths between tasks. The key is to make these pauses intentional, not reactive.

Core Frameworks: How Micro-Recovery Works
To understand why micro-recovery is effective, it helps to look at the underlying frameworks that explain how our bodies and minds respond to stress and rest. One key model is the stress-recovery continuum, which posits that stress and recovery are on a spectrum. When you experience stress—whether from a demanding task, an emotional interaction, or physical exertion—your body activates the sympathetic nervous system, releasing cortisol and adrenaline. Recovery, conversely, engages the parasympathetic system, promoting relaxation and repair. Micro-recovery allows you to shift from sympathetic to parasympathetic dominance in short bursts, preventing the accumulation of allostatic load—the wear and tear on the body from chronic stress. Another framework is attention restoration theory, which suggests that directed attention (used in focused work) depletes over time. Micro-recovery, especially when involving natural stimuli (like looking at greenery or listening to calm sounds), helps restore directed attention, making you more focused when you return to work. A third framework is the concept of 'energy management' versus 'time management.' Time management focuses on scheduling tasks, while energy management recognizes that your capacity to perform fluctuates. Micro-recovery is a tool for energy management, allowing you to match your energy levels to task demands. For instance, a writer I know uses a 90-second breathing exercise before starting a challenging section. This brief reset lowers their anxiety and sharpens their focus. These frameworks collectively show that micro-recovery isn't a luxury—it's a biological necessity for sustained high performance.
Understanding the Stress-Recovery Cycle
The stress-recovery cycle is a continuous loop. Each stressor triggers a response, and if recovery doesn't occur, the next stressor builds on the previous one. This is why a series of small, unrelieved stressors—like constant email notifications or back-to-back meetings—can be more draining than a single intense event. Micro-recovery interrupts this accumulation. For example, after a tense client call, taking 30 seconds to breathe deeply can reset your emotional state. Without that reset, you carry the tension into your next task, affecting your judgment and interactions. In one case, a project manager noticed that after implementing 1-minute 'reset' breaks between meetings, her team reported feeling less irritable and more collaborative. The cycle was broken.
The Role of Autonomic Nervous System
Your autonomic nervous system has two branches: sympathetic (fight or flight) and parasympathetic (rest and digest). Modern work life tends to keep the sympathetic branch overactivated. Micro-recovery exercises—like slow breathing, stretching, or brief meditation—activate the parasympathetic branch. This reduces heart rate, lowers blood pressure, and decreases muscle tension. Over time, regular micro-recovery can improve your baseline stress tolerance. A common analogy is that of a rubber band: if you stretch it constantly without release, it loses elasticity. Micro-recovery is the release that maintains your resilience.
Attention Restoration Theory in Practice
Attention restoration theory distinguishes between directed attention (focused, effortful) and involuntary attention (effortless, captured by interesting stimuli). Directed attention fatigues easily. Micro-recovery that engages involuntary attention—like gazing at a nature scene, listening to birds, or even looking at a calming image—can restore directed attention. This is why a quick walk outside or a moment of daydreaming can be so refreshing. In a workplace setting, you can simulate this by taking a 60-second break to look at a plant or a photo of a landscape. The key is to shift your focus away from demanding tasks.

Step-by-Step Daily Routine
Here's a concrete daily schedule for incorporating micro-recovery: 1) Morning start: After your first 90-minute work block (around 10 AM), take a 2-minute break. Stand up, stretch your arms overhead, and take five slow breaths. 2) Pre-lunch reset: Before lunch, take 1 minute to close your eyes and focus on your breath. This helps you transition from work mode to a restorative break. 3) Post-lunch revival: After eating, take a 3-minute walk (even if it's just around your desk). This aids digestion and re-energizes you. 4) Mid-afternoon booster: Around 3 PM, when energy naturally dips, do a 2-minute progressive muscle relaxation. Tense your shoulders for 5 seconds, then release. Repeat for your hands, legs, and jaw. 5) End-of-day wind-down: Before finishing work, take 1 minute to review what you accomplished and set an intention for the next day. This mental closure prevents carryover stress. This routine adds up to only 9 minutes of breaks per day, yet it can significantly improve your energy and focus.

Risks, Pitfalls, and Common Mistakes to Avoid
While micro-recovery is beneficial, there are common pitfalls that can undermine its effectiveness. The first mistake is waiting until you're exhausted to take a break. By then, your energy is already depleted, and recovery takes longer. Instead, take breaks proactively at regular intervals, before fatigue sets in. A second mistake is using your break time to scroll through social media or check emails. These activities are not restorative—they engage your brain and may increase stress. True micro-recovery requires disengagement from work and screens. A third pitfall is taking breaks that are too long. If your break exceeds 5-10 minutes, you risk losing momentum and having trouble refocusing. Stick to 30 seconds to 3 minutes. Another common error is inconsistent practice. If you only take breaks when you remember, you won't build the habit. Use triggers and reminders. Some people also fall into the trap of 'all or nothing' thinking: if they miss one break, they give up entirely. Instead, aim for consistency, not perfection. A fifth mistake is neglecting physical cues. Your body gives signals like yawning, fidgeting, or eye strain. Ignoring these cues leads to cumulative fatigue. Learn to recognize them and respond immediately. Finally, a significant risk is using micro-recovery as a substitute for longer, deeper rest. Micro-recovery is not a replacement for a good night's sleep or a vacation. It's a complement. If you're chronically sleep-deprived, micro-recovery alone won't fix it. Address foundational health issues first. To mitigate these risks, adopt a structured approach: plan your breaks, choose restorative activities, and monitor your energy. If you notice yourself slipping, revisit your triggers or try a new activity. Remember, the goal is to make micro-recovery a sustainable part of your routine, not a chore.
Mistake 1: Using Screen-Based Breaks
One of the most common mistakes is using your phone or computer during a break. Scrolling through news, social media, or even work-related messages keeps your brain active and prevents true rest. The blue light from screens can also disrupt your circadian rhythm. Instead, choose screen-free activities: stretch, breathe, walk, or simply close your eyes. If you must use a device, listen to calming music or a short guided meditation without looking at the screen.
Mistake 2: Inconsistent Timing
Another pitfall is taking breaks at random times. For micro-recovery to be effective, it should align with your ultradian rhythms. The ideal schedule is every 90 minutes, but you can adjust based on your work demands. If you wait too long between breaks, you'll be operating on low energy. If you take breaks too frequently, you may interrupt flow. Find a rhythm that works for you, and stick to it consistently.
Mistake 3: Not Matching Activity to Need
Different types of fatigue require different recovery activities. If you're mentally drained, a mindfulness exercise may help. If you're physically stiff, stretching is better. If you're emotionally stressed, deep breathing or a quick walk can help. Pay attention to what your body and mind need, and choose accordingly. A one-size-fits-all approach may not work. For example, after a long meeting, you might need a quiet, introspective break. After a repetitive task, you might need movement.

Can Micro-Recovery Replace a Nap?
No, micro-recovery is not a substitute for sleep or a power nap. Naps typically last 10-20 minutes and involve a different physiological process. Micro-recovery is for quick resets during the day. If you're severely sleep-deprived, you need longer rest. Use micro-recovery as a supplement to good sleep hygiene, not a replacement.
